Abstract :
Holistic approaches of face recognition are not robust to illumination, scale, occlusion and age variations. Various studies indicate that the performance of holistic approaches degrades as the face database size increases. In this paper, we propose a user specific landmark geometry based approach that assigns weights to different geometrical distances according to their role in face recognition process. The term user specific implies that, the feature vector of each face in the database comprises a unique set of features. The idea is inspired by the fact that, humans recognize individuals by identifying one´s unique characteristics (e.g. unusually long nose or big eyes). We propose a method to identify these characteristics and use them as features for particular face. Experimental results show that our specific feature approach has better accuracy and faster than available technique.
